"A Unified Field Theory"

A Unified Field Theory is a scientific idea that aims to combine all the fundamental forces of nature—such as gravity, electromagnetism, and the nuclear forces—into a single, comprehensive framework. Currently, these forces are described separately by different theories, making it challenging to understand how they interact seamlessly. A unified theory would reveal the underlying principles that connect them, providing a deeper understanding of the universe's fundamental workings. While still a goal of modern physics, no complete unified theory has yet been established.
